The phrase "aims to coordinate"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when describing the intention or goal of an individual or organization to bring together different elements or parties for a common purpose.
Example: "The committee aims to coordinate efforts between various departments to improve overall efficiency."
Alternatives: "seeks to organize" or "intends to align".
